#7: Stablecoins, CBDCs and the evolution of Defi

What are stable coins? and why does an ecosystem so determined to achieve decentralisation still rely on them? In conversation with Nadia Alvarez from Maker Dao, and Nestor Palao from Sygnum Bank we dive into the role of stable coins in def and how the market is evolving, particularly with the rise of CBDCs and governments experimenting with crypto.
- What is the role of stable coins in the crypto market, particularly in defi-lending?
- How does a DAO-driven stable coin differ from other more centralized players in the sector?
- How does a decentralized coin that is independent survive against the upcoming CBDCs?
- Do stable coins offer a potential solution for markets where the economies are less stable?
